Job Description

A specialist setting in Worcestershire is seeking a dedicated Teaching Assistant to support a small class of 10 pupils across Years 1–3. The pupils have a range of needs including Severe Learning Difficulties (SLD) and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D), so this role is ideal for someone with strong SEND experience and a calm, nurturing approach.

Key Responsibilities
Support pupils across Years 1–3 within a small specialist class
Provide classroom and small group support tailored to pupils with SLD and ASD
Assist with communication, engagement, and emotional regulation
Work closely with the class teacher and SEND team
Help create a safe, structured, and supportive learning environment

Desired Experience + Qualifications

  • Experience supporting pupils with ASD and/or SLD

  • Previous classroom or SEND school experience

  • Patient, resilient, and nurturing approach

  • Strong communication and teamwork skills

  • DBS on the Update Service or willingness to obtain one

About the School

This Worcestershire specialist setting provides a structured and supportive environment where pupils with complex needs are encouraged to develop confidence, communication, and independence. Staff work collaboratively to ensure children receive personalised support and meaningful learning experiences.
